When Page Dickey moved away from her celebrated garden at Duck Hill, she left a landscape she had spent thirty-four years making, nurturing, and loving. She found her next chapter in northwestern Connecticut, on 17 acres of rolling fields and woodland around a former Methodist church. In Uprooted, Dickey reflects on this transition and on what it means for a gardener to start again. The surprise at the heart of the book? Although Dickey was sad to leave her beloved garden, she found herself thrilled to begin a new garden in a wilder, larger landscape.

For anyone who loves to read all the gritty and delightful details of starting a garden on a new
property, this is the story for you. I can find no negatives here. I felt as though I were walking along with the author as she first explored the land and then set about restoring it in a more natural way. It’s also a tale about scaling back on garden maintenance as one grows older. I can relate. And just a word about the narrator….exceptionally good. I would hope to find more narratives like like this one.
